Biography
Reason: He played baseball at school and wanted to follow a career in the sport. However, once his family moved to Ciego de Avila, Cuba, he was invited to a running competition in Matanzas, Cuba. "I had never competed in athletics but as it meant I had to skip classes for a week, I accepted." Afterwards he was offered a scholarship at a sports school. (invasor.cu, 01 Jan 2024)
Awards: In 2023 and 2015 he was named Para Athlete of the Year of the Ciego de Avila province in Cuba. (invasor.cu, 19 Dec 2023, 03 Dec 2015)
He was named among the 10 Outstanding Paralympic Athletes in Cuba in 2012, 2013, and 2014 by the Cuban Sports Institute [INDER] and the Cuban sports journalists association. (periodico26.cu, 11 Dec 2012; radiohc.cu, 15 Dec 2013; jit.cu, 11 Dec 2014; granma.cu, 07 Dec 2015)
Sporting Relatives: His brother Raul has represented Cuba in baseball. (baseball-reference.com, 16 Apr 2013)
